- 1、本文档共32页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
PAGE1
PAGE1
文档与报告管理
在化工实验室信息管理系统(LIMS)中,文档与报告管理是一个重要的模块,它涉及实验室运行过程中产生的各类文档和报告的创建、存储、检索、审批和归档。LabLynxLIMS提供了强大的文档与报告管理功能,但有时需要根据特定实验室的需求进行二次开发,以满足更复杂的业务流程和管理要求。
文档管理
文档分类与存储
文档管理的第一步是文档的分类和存储。LabLynxLIMS中的文档可以分为多种类型,如标准操作规程(SOP)、实验记录、质量控制文件、仪器校准记录等。每种类型的文档都有其特定的存储路径和管理规则。
文档分类
文档分类可以通过定义文档类型和分类规则来实现。在LabLynxLIMS中,可以通过后台管理界面或API来创建和管理文档类型。
#示例:通过API创建文档类型
importrequests
importjson
#定义文档类型
document_type={
name:SOP,
description:标准操作规程文档,
category:Procedures,
file_extension:pdf,
retention_period:5years
}
#发送请求
url=https://your-lablynx-api-url/document_types
headers={
Content-Type:application/json,
Authorization:Beareryour-api-token
}
response=requests.post(url,headers=headers,data=json.dumps(document_type))
#检查响应
ifresponse.status_code==201:
print(文档类型创建成功)
else:
print(f文档类型创建失败:{response.status_code}-{response.text})
文档上传与存储
文档上传和存储是文档管理的核心功能。LabLynxLIMS提供了多种方式来上传文档,包括通过用户界面手动上传和通过API自动上传。文档存储路径可以自定义,以满足实验室的管理需求。
通过用户界面上传文档
通过用户界面上传文档是最常见的方法。用户可以在文档管理模块中选择对应的文档类型,然后上传文件。系统会自动将文件存储在指定路径,并生成相应的元数据记录。
通过API上传文档
通过API上传文档可以实现自动化文档管理,特别适用于批量上传或集成其他系统。
#示例:通过API上传文档
importrequests
#定义文档上传数据
document_data={
document_type_id:1,
title:实验记录1,
description:实验记录1的描述,
category:ExperimentalRecords,
file:(record1.pdf,open(record1.pdf,rb))
}
#发送请求
url=https://your-lablynx-api-url/documents
headers={
Authorization:Beareryour-api-token
}
response=requests.post(url,headers=headers,files=document_data)
#检查响应
ifresponse.status_code==201:
print(文档上传成功)
else:
print(f文档上传失败:{response.status_code}-{response.text})
文档检索与管理
文档检索是确保实验室人员能够快速找到所需文档的重要功能。LabLynxLIMS提供了多种检索方式,包括按文档类型、标题、描述、上传日期等进行检索。
按文档类型检索
#示例:按文档类型检索文档
importrequests
#定义检索参数
params={
document_type_id:1
}
#发送请求
url=https://your-lablynx-api-url/documents
headers={
Authorization:Beareryo
您可能关注的文档
- 化工过程控制软件:Wonderware二次开发_(8).动态仿真与模型建立.docx
- 化工过程控制软件:Wonderware二次开发_(9).报表与打印功能.docx
- 化工过程控制软件:Wonderware二次开发_(10).安全管理与权限设置.docx
- 化工过程控制软件:Wonderware二次开发_(11).系统集成与通信协议.docx
- 化工过程控制软件:Wonderware二次开发_(12).故障诊断与维护.docx
- 化工过程控制软件:Wonderware二次开发_(13).案例分析与实践操作.docx
- 化工过程控制软件:Wonderware二次开发_(14).二次开发工具与环境.docx
- 化工过程控制软件:Wonderware二次开发_(15).脚本语言与编程基础.docx
- 化工过程控制软件:Wonderware二次开发_(16).数据库接口与数据管理.docx
- 化工过程控制软件:Wonderware二次开发_(17).高级功能定制.docx
文档评论(0)